🧵 Plush Bunny Pillow – Step-by-Step Sewing Instructions

Create a soft, cuddly bunny with this beginner-friendly sewing guide!


📌 Important Notes Before You Start

  • No seam allowances included in the pattern! ➤ Add your preferred seam allowance (typically 0.5 cm–1 cm) when cutting your fabric.

  • Use soft fleece, minky, or plush fabric for a cuddly finish.

  • Always cut the number of pieces listed on each pattern part.


🐰 What You’ll Need:

  • Printed pattern (enlarged to desired size)

  • Fabric (plush, fleece, or soft cotton)

  • Stuffing (polyester fiberfill)

  • Matching thread

  • Pins or clips

  • Fabric marker or chalk

  • Sewing machine (or needle for hand sewing)

  • Optional: Embroidery floss or felt for face details


✂️ Step 1: Cut the Fabric Pieces

Using the pattern:

  • Foot pillow – 1 piece (cut on fold)

  • Paw pillow – 2 pieces

  • Paw detail – 1 piece

  • Paw sub-details (toes) – 6 pieces

  • Nose pillow – 1 piece

Don’t forget to add seam allowances!


📍 Step 2: Prepare the Paw Pad

  1. Position the 6 sub-detail toe pads on the Paw detail piece, using the dashed ovals as placement guides.

  2. Sew each one in place using a tight zigzag stitch or by hand with a ladder stitch for an invisible seam.


🧷 Step 3: Assemble the Paw

  1. Place the Paw detail on one of the Paw pillow pieces and stitch it down securely.

  2. Place the second Paw pillow piece right sides together with the first.

  3. Stitch around the edge, leaving a small gap for turning.

  4. Turn the paw inside out and stuff firmly.

  5. Stitch the opening closed by hand.


🧵 Step 4: Sew the Nose Pillow

  1. Fold the Nose pillow piece in half or use two layers if desired for volume.

  2. Stitch around the edge, leave an opening.

  3. Turn, stuff, and close the opening.


🐾 Step 5: Make the Main Foot Pillow

  1. Fold the Foot pillow piece in half as indicated (if cut on fold).

  2. Place the finished Paw and Nose pillows inside the main pillow area where you’d like them to be visible.

  3. Pin in place if needed.

  4. Sew around the edge of the foot pillow, leaving a large opening.

  5. Turn right side out, stuff fully, and hand-sew the opening shut.


🌟 Optional Embellishments

  • Add a face with embroidered eyes, nose, or felt details.

  • Add a hanging loop or bow for decoration.

  • Stitch extra lines for finger definition.


Professional Sewing Tips

  • Use a walking foot when sewing thick plush fabric.

  • Clip corners and curves before turning for a smoother shape.

  • Hand-sewing with a ladder stitch gives the cleanest finish for closing gaps.

  • Always test your stitch tension on scrap fabric first.
